Beyond that, all of your liquids must fit in one quart-sized resealable bag.
If you want to travel with more liquids or larger-sized containers, they must bepacked in your checked bag.
Youll also want to be mindful of your trip destination and any intended activities.
For instance, if youre traveling to a colder climate, be prepared for drier skin and chapped lips.
If youre headed to a beachy location, dont forget toload up on sunscreen.
